The 1984 Sondheim-James Lapine musical play uses inspiration from Georges Seurat's famous pointillist painting "Sunday Afternoon on the Island of La Grande Jatte" to explore art, emotional connection, and community. In 1884 Paris, artist Georges-Pierre Seurat is immersed in single-minded concentration while painting his masterpiece. The people in his life provide inspiration for the characters in the painting, springing to life on the canvas and melding life and art. 100 years later, his great-grandson George, also an artist, struggles in the world of modern art.
